C20-40 Alketh-10 (INCI: C20-40 Alketh-10) is a nonionic emulsifier. It binds the oil and water phases and stabilizes the formula, which keeps creams and lotions from separating. This is a functional ingredient, not a skincare active. Its work is structural: keeping the emulsion stable. It gives no direct benefit to skin and should not be judged as a skincare active. Because of its topical use and lack of systemic relevance, it can be used during pregnancy and breastfeeding without concern. Tolerance is good. It is a mild surfactant, with low irritation and allergy potential, comfortable on sensitive skin. Most skin shows no reaction.
